как сделать домашний vpn сервер

🔧 Настройка туннеля 📡 Протоколы шифрования 🔗 Безопасность соединения 🚫 Защита от утечек 🧩 Туннельные протоколы 🔐 Криптография

как сделать домашний vpn сервер

image
image

Создание собственного VPN-сервера дома — это отличный способ повысить уровень приватности, получить доступ к локальным ресурсам и обеспечить безопасное соединение для всех устройств в сети. В этой статье я расскажу, как сделать домашний VPN сервер шаг за шагом, чтобы даже новичок смог справиться с задачей, не теряя при этом в безопасности и надежности.

Зачем нужен домашний VPN сервер?

Перед тем как перейти к инструкции, важно понять, зачем вообще создавать домашний VPN сервер:

  • Защита данных при использовании публичных Wi-Fi сетей.
  • Обеспечение доступа к домашней сети из любой точки мира.
  • Обход гео-ограничений и цензуры.
  • Контроль над своими данными и устройствами.

Что потребуется для создания домашнего VPN сервера?

Минимум — это стабильно работающий компьютер или Raspberry Pi, стабильное интернет-соединение и немного времени. Кроме того, понадобится выбрать подходящее программное обеспечение и настроить его.

Шаг 1: Выбор оборудования

Для домашнего VPN подойдет любой компьютер или даже Raspberry Pi — это недорого и энергоэффективно. Главное — чтобы устройство было всегда включено и подключено к сети.

Шаг 2: Установка операционной системы

Наиболее популярные варианты — это Linux (например, Ubuntu или Debian), Windows или macOS. Для новичков я рекомендую Linux — он бесплатен, стабилен и хорошо подходит для серверных задач.

Шаг 3: Установка VPN-сервера

Самый распространенный и проверенный вариант — это OpenVPN. Он хорошо документирован, поддерживается сообществом и безопасен.

Инструкция по установке OpenVPN на Ubuntu:

  1. Обновите систему:

sudo apt update && sudo apt upgrade -y

  1. Установите OpenVPN и необходимые скрипты:

sudo apt install openvpn easy-rsa -y

  1. Настройте PKI (Public Key Infrastructure) — создайте сертификаты и ключи:

make-cadir ~/openvpn-ca cd ~/openvpn-ca source vars ./clean-all ./build-ca

  1. Создайте сертификаты сервера и клиентов, а также ключи Диффи-Хеллмана, необходимые для шифрования.

  2. Настройте конфигурационный файл сервера и клиента.

Шаг 4: Настройка маршрутизации и проброс портов

Чтобы подключаться извне, нужно открыть порт 1194 (по умолчанию для OpenVPN) на вашем роутере и перенаправить его на устройство с VPN-сервером.

Шаг 5: Генерация сертификатов и ключей для клиентов

Это позволит вам подключаться к VPN с разных устройств — компьютеров, смартфонов, планшетов.

Шаг 6: Тестирование соединения

После настройки запустите сервер и попробуйте подключиться с другого устройства, используя созданные сертификаты и конфигурационные файлы.

Дополнительные советы:

  • Используйте статический IP или настройте DDNS, чтобы иметь постоянный адрес для подключения.
  • Обновляйте программное обеспечение и сертификаты регулярно.
  • Сделайте резервные копии конфигурационных файлов и ключей.

Заключение

Создание домашнего VPN сервера — не так сложно, как кажется. Главное — следовать инструкции, уделять внимание безопасности и регулярно обновлять систему. Такой сервер позволит вам не только защитить свои данные, но и расширить возможности домашней сети, открыв доступ к ней из любой точки мира.

Если у вас возникнут вопросы или потребуется помощь — ищите подробные гайды и сообщества, посвященные OpenVPN и другим VPN-решениям. Ваша безопасность — в ваших руках!


🔧 Настройка туннеля 📡 Протоколы шифрования 🔗 Безопасность соединения 🚫 Защита от утечек 🧩 Туннельные протоколы 🔐 Криптография

Присоединиться к обсуждению

Комментариев пока нет.

Оставить комментарий

Решите простую математическую задачу для защиты от ботов